Why Stihl Chainsaw Ignition Module Is Necessary

From my experience, the ignition module is one of the most important parts of a Stihl chainsaw because it creates the spark needed to start the engine and keep it running smoothly. Without it, the fuel and air mixture inside the engine cannot ignite, which means the chainsaw simply will not operate. I have found that when the ignition module works properly, the saw starts easier and runs more reliably.

I also appreciate that the ignition module helps maintain consistent engine performance. In my use, a strong and steady spark makes a big difference in cutting power, throttle response, and overall efficiency. When this part begins to fail, I notice hard starting, misfires, or sudden stalling, all of which can interrupt work and reduce productivity.

Another reason I consider it necessary is safety and dependability. A properly functioning ignition module helps my chainsaw perform as expected, which gives me more confidence while working. For me, it is a small part with a very big job, and keeping it in good condition is essential for dependable operation.

My Buying Guides on Stihl Chainsaw Ignition Module

What I Look for in a Stihl Chainsaw Ignition Module

When I shop for a Stihl chainsaw ignition module, I first make sure it matches my exact chainsaw model. I have learned that even small differences in engine size or model number can affect compatibility. I also check whether the module is OEM or aftermarket, because I want reliable performance and easy installation.

Why Compatibility Matters to Me

For me, compatibility is the most important factor. If the ignition module does not fit properly, my chainsaw may not start, may run poorly, or may fail completely. I always compare the part number from my old module with the replacement listing before I buy anything.

OEM vs Aftermarket: What I Prefer

I usually decide between OEM and aftermarket based on my budget and how often I use the saw. OEM modules give me confidence in quality and fit, while aftermarket options can save money. If I use my chainsaw often, I lean toward OEM. If I need a quick replacement for lighter use, I may consider a trusted aftermarket brand.

Signs I Need a New Ignition Module

I look for a few common warning signs before replacing the module. If my chainsaw has trouble starting, loses spark, stalls unexpectedly, or runs inconsistently, I suspect the ignition module. I also inspect it for visible damage, cracks, or heat wear.

Quality Features I Pay Attention To

I prefer an ignition module that feels durable and is built with good insulation. I also look for strong customer reviews, clear product specifications, and a warranty if available. These details help me feel more confident that the part will last.

Installation Ease

I like modules that are easy to install with basic tools. Before buying, I check whether the seller provides instructions or a fitment guide. If the installation looks complicated, I make sure I am comfortable doing the work myself or plan to get help.

Price vs Value

I do not always choose the cheapest option. Instead, I think about value. A slightly more expensive ignition module is worth it to me if it lasts longer and helps my chainsaw run smoothly. I try to balance cost, quality, and reliability.

My Final Buying Tip

My best advice is to verify the model number, compare part numbers, and buy from a seller with a good return policy. That way, I reduce the risk of getting the wrong ignition module and make sure my Stihl chainsaw gets back to working the way I want.
